Ablation Catheters Market Recent Developments
-  
In August 2023, Medtronic introduced an upgraded ClosureFast RF ablation catheter with a reduced 6F profile in the U.S., following clearance from the U.S. FDA. This minimally invasive procedure is designed to treat Chronic Venous Insufficiency (CVI), a progressive vein condition. It is estimated that nearly 30 million people in the U.S. are affected by CVI.
 -  
In August 2023, Boston Scientific Corporation received clearance from the U.S. FDA for its POLARx Cryoablation System. This advanced system is developed to treat patients with paroxysmal atrial fibrillation and features the POLARx FIT Cryoablation Balloon Catheter, enhancing precision and efficiency during cardiac procedures.

Radiofrequency Ablation
Radiofrequency (RF) catheters remain a mainstay due to mature clinical outcomes, wide operator familiarity, and integration with advanced 3D mapping systems. Growth strategies focus on contact-force sensing, irrigated tips, and temperature control to enhance lesion consistency and reduce complications. As EP programs scale, RF suppliers leverage portfolio breadth and service contracts to defend share while addressing challenges like procedure time and variability across centers.
Cryoablation
Cryoablation adoption is supported by streamlined pulmonary vein isolation workflows and predictable lesion formation for specific arrhythmia targets. Vendors emphasize ease of use, reproducibility, and reduced learning curves, appealing to sites standardizing protocols. Partnerships in training, proctoring, and data collection underpin expansion, while stakeholders assess cost-effectiveness versus RF in mixed case mixes and navigate challenges in device availability and ancillary disposables.
Pulse Field Ablation
Pulse Field Ablation (PFA) represents an emerging modality characterized by non-thermal, tissue-selective electroporation that aims to improve safety and workflow efficiency. Market participants pursue regulatory approvals, real-world evidence generation, and ecosystem integration with mapping and imaging platforms. Early commercialization strategies include targeted launches at high-volume EP centers, physician education, and partnerships to scale manufacturing, while addressing challenges around capital planning and protocol standardization.

Expanding Applications beyond Cardiac Arrhythmias - The global market for ablation catheters, traditionally utilized primarily in treating cardiac arrhythmias, is undergoing a significant expansion in its applications. Beyond their established role in cardiac procedures, ablation catheters are increasingly being employed in various medical specialties and procedures, reflecting their versatility and effectiveness in minimally invasive interventions.
One notable area of expansion is in the field of oncology, where ablation catheters are utilized in the treatment of tumors, particularly in cases where surgery is not feasible or desirable. Techniques such as radiofrequency ablation (RFA) and microwave ablation (MWA) are being employed to destroy cancerous tissue, offering patients a less invasive alternative to traditional surgery and often resulting in quicker recovery times.
The applications of ablation catheters are extending into gastroenterology, with procedures such as endoscopic radiofrequency ablation (ERFA) being used to treat conditions like Barrett's esophagus and certain types of gastrointestinal cancers. This minimally invasive approach offers patients an alternative to more invasive surgical procedures, with potentially fewer complications and shorter recovery times.
The use of ablation catheters is expanding into the realm of pain management, where techniques such as radiofrequency ablation (RFA) and cryoablation are utilized to target and disrupt nerve pathways involved in chronic pain conditions. By precisely targeting specific nerves or pain pathways, these procedures can provide long-lasting relief for patients suffering from chronic pain, improving their quality of life.
The global market for ablation catheters is experiencing a significant expansion in its applications, extending beyond cardiac arrhythmias into oncology, gastroenterology, and pain management. With their proven efficacy and minimally invasive nature, ablation catheters are increasingly becoming a versatile tool in the arsenal of medical professionals across various specialties, offering patients less invasive treatment options and improved outcomes.
